What is the true total cost of owning a home in Auburn?

True homeownership costs go beyond principal and interest. In Auburn, a typical homeowner with a median-priced home of $332,158 can expect to pay roughly $3,645/yr in property taxes, $900/yr for homeowners insurance, and $1,984/yr in energy utilities. That adds approximately $544 per month in ongoing costs on top of your mortgage payment. Use our calculator above to model your exact all-in monthly cost.
